When I woke up in the morning, there was a mountain of fruit on the laboratory desk.

When I asked Maito what had happened, she gave me an indescribable look.

“We thought we’d do something that can only be done in another world.”

…I know.

We’ve all been trying various things with that in mind these past few days.

“And then, I thought… In this world, food isn’t free.”

Right.

“No matter how expensive the ingredients are, to put it badly, it can be settled with your physical labor. If it can be bought with money, sewing a dress by myself mostly settles it.”

Right.

“So, I have a question for Kadomi-kun. …How often did you eat fruits in our original world?”

…Fruits?

I don’t think they were something I ate that often…

…Um…

“I don’t remember.”

“Ah, yes. You don’t pay much attention to eating, do you…”

I don’t really remember what I used to eat every day in the original world.

…What kind of things, or rather, what kind of menu, dishes… that is.

I don’t remember if fruits were included in the meals.

“…Well, um, probably not very frequently, I think. In Japan, fruits are on a path to high-quality… only expensive and delicious fruits exist. So honestly, I don’t think there’s much point in purposely buying expensive fruits.”

Is that so? …Probably, but still.

“So I thought! …Let’s eat lots of fruits while we’re in another world…”

“It’s not about meat, you know.”

“…Well, because, look… For meat, we don’t need your help. But with fruits, see, we can just ask the maid dolls.”

As if to prove Maito’s words, the laboratory door opened with a clatter, and the maid dolls came in, one after the other.

Each of them was carrying a piece of fruit… The larger ones were cut or rolled in, some carried by several dolls.

“Alright, alright. The fragile ones go here. …Ah, I wish they hadn’t cut the oranges… Oh, well. We’ll serve it for breakfast.”

Following Maito’s instructions, the maid dolls piled the fruits on the desk.

…It looked like a line of ants.

After watching for a while, the maid dolls went back outside.

It still looked like a line of ants.

That day, we went to play at the Deichemoore arena.

Katori said he wanted the minerals that were prizes. So I guess more Gundams will be added.

Today was a battle royale format. Since it wasn’t one-on-one, we decided to participate fully just to be safe.

…Maito stayed behind. If Maito went to the arena, she’d die…

…By the way, when we participate, we fight with handicaps. Otherwise, it wouldn’t be fair, apparently.

“So that’s why there was such a huge amount of fruits.”

Suzumoto is fighting in the center stage of the arena, chained by one foot. Strong.

“I want apple pie! Like the one at that certain hamburger chain. The kind where the inside is oozy!”

Hariu is fighting with his arms tied behind his back. Strong.

“Making pie crust is troublesome, so it won’t be ready until tomorrow at the earliest, I suppose.”

President is fighting blindfolded. Strong.

“Hmm, I mean no offense, but Maito seems a bit frugal, doesn’t she? Even coming to another world, she thinks about the price of food… Ah, Kadomi-kun, to your right, please.”

“Got it.”

Toriumi is fighting in a situation where we are back to back with our hands and feet tied together. Troublesome.

“But now that you mention it, fruits really are expensive, aren’t they? Not just fruits… woah! Ha, Hagasaki-kun, give me a break, please.”

A block of ice flew over the head of Kariya, who was shackled by the ankles.

…Hagasaki-kun had his wand taken away and his mouth tied so he couldn’t chant spells. That’s why he seems to be struggling with controlling his magic. It seems Hagasaki-kun is getting frustrated. Scary.

“Why is everyone talking while fighting, huh, ei!”

Katori is fighting with a ban on shooting… It’s my first time seeing Katori punch someone… Somehow… it’s shocking.

“Hmm, maybe because it’s boring?”

“This is part of the handicap!”

…I think our handicaps are quite severe, but even so… soon, we were the only ones left on the stage.

Katori immediately took the prize minerals with a happy look. Good for him.

“Then, I’ll go make Unit 5.”

And he disappeared.

…Huh, was there a Unit 4?… He must have made it at some point.

“So, what do we do in the meantime? It’s boring.”

“We don’t have enough people for Werewolf, do we? And Maito-san isn’t here either.”

When we got back, Maito was processing the fruits. She didn’t seem bored. The laboratory was a battlefield. It was scary.

“Maito is also quite thrifty, isn’t she? Why go to the trouble with fruits? There are plenty of other expensive foods.”

“Because we can’t gather them ourselves, she said.โ€

…Somehow, Hagasaki-kun seemed to dislike the idea. But when Hagasaki-kun looks displeased, he often doesn’t really mind.

“…What are expensive foods? I can only think of shark fin.”

“What about melons?… Oh, that’s a fruit…”

“Hmm, they often have first auctions for tuna, but have we eaten tuna already?”

“There’s also something called bird’s nest. I don’t know if it exists in this world.”

“Saffron is famously a very expensive spice.”

“Eh, is that delicious?”

…Now that you mention it, I can’t imagine the taste of expensive foods. I don’t even know where to find them.

“…Shall we try them?”

…Is it because I’m thrifty? No, it’s okay, this much…

“Shark fin is from a shark’s fin, right?”

“That’s right.”

That’s why we came to the sea.

…I remembered seeing creatures like sharks when we entered the sea before.

“…Are we going to swim out?”

“No, there’s a simpler way.”

I don’t like swimming, but when Hagasaki-kun looked displeased, President looked pleased. …I have a bad feeling about this.

“Sharks, they are attracted to blood.”

President, pulling out Hariu’s short sword nearby, slashed his wrist…!

“This should attract them.”

And then, he let the blood from his wound drip into the sea…!

“No, no, no, no, no! What are you doing!”

“Kariyaโ€•! Kariyaโ€•!”

“Ahhhhhhh nooooooo!”

…I’m going to pretend I saw nothing.

I’ve seen plenty of wounds before… but President, smiling while cutting his wrist and dripping blood… that was different.

While Kariya was healing President’s wrist, the sea started to get rough.

“It’s a shark.”

“It’s a shark.”

“It’s a shark.”

“Yay, shark fins swimming!”

Attracted by the scent of President’s blood, lots of sharks… or something like them, were coming.

“So, Hagasaki-kun, please take care of it!”

“Which one?”

“Well, for now, just deal with all of them, and we can sort them out later, right?”

“Oh, okay. ‘Ice Pillar.'”

The shark-like creatures were speared by the pillars of ice that sprouted from the sea and came out onto the surface.

Suzumoto and Hariu collected them and casually threw them onto the sandy beach.

…Um.

“Are these… sharks?”

Their fangs looked like blades, and their fins looked like blades too.

“The ones with blade-like fins can’t be eaten as shark fins.”

“Can you even eat shark meat…?”

…After Suzumoto and Hariu returned, we decided to take everything back and have Maito figure it out.

If they’re in the way, we could just have them “cleaned up.”

Since President mentioned that “the swallows that make nests edible as food live along the coast,” we kept looking along the coast and… found something.

“Those are swallows. Their pattern and tail are exactly like those of swallows. If we look, we might find their nests too. Let’s search for a cave nearby.”

“Wait a minute, something’s off. If my memory serves right, swallows don’t wear armor, nor are they giant creatures about 2 meters long.”

…What flew over us was a huge bird.

About 2 meters long. Wearing armor. Its feathers were steel-colored. Probably blade-like.

“If they’re big, it means their nests are big too. That saves us the trouble of collecting multiple nests.”

The swallows weren’t swallows, but President was still President.

It took some time to take control of the cave we found, but we managed to collect something resembling swallow nests… They were huge. I could easily fit inside one.

…Come to think of it, Maito once said, “If there were huge broad beans, I’d like to nap in their pods.”

…If we find broad beans, let’s take them back.

“Looks like it’s Chinese cuisine today.”

“Should we catch some meat to take back too?”

“What counts as expensive meat?”

“Kobe beef…?”

“Seems unlikely to find that in another world.”

“It would be scary if we did.”

“Sounds strong.”

“What would a Black Wagyu monster look like, I wonder…”

Probably, it would have huge horns, a massive body, and I think it would taste awful.

Then we caught some meat and returned.

Maito, with Katori’s help, was disassembling a shark. I think what’s rolling by the window are its fins.

“You guys are really! Seriously! Frugal, “disassemble”! Why do you catch everything, “disassemble”, and bring it back! “Disassemble”!”

The sharks, larger than Maito’s body, seemed to be a hassle to deal with after disassembling. Carrying the meat, processing the bones…

…Um, sorry.

“The scale is bigger than Maito, right?”

“So what! You guys are petite bourgeoisie too! “Disassemble”! “Disassemble”! “Disassemble”!”

“Why not just “clean” it up?”

“That’s wasteful!”

“Ha-ha, Maito-san’s frugalityโ€•”

“Pot calling the kettle black! You’re all petite bourgeoisie! Petite bourgeoisie!”

…I guess it can’t be helped.

We’re all just average high school students. Petite bourgeoisie… Yeah, that sounds about right.

The day’s meal consisted of a large shark fin stew, a giant bird’s nest soup, pork buns, braised pork, and various other dishes.

…The shark fin was kind of… jelly-like, like vermicelli… If you ask me if it’s delicious, I’m not really sure.

I’m even more unsure about the bird’s nest. What is this, exactly?

“Ordinary meat tastes better, doesn’t it?”

“No good, I can’t tell the deliciousness of expensive foods.”

“It doesn’t feel worth it to pay and eat these things.”

Everyone had similar opinions.

…Well, because we’re petite bourgeoisie.

“What shall we catch tomorrow?”

“What else is considered expensive?”

“Please choose something whose cooking method we understand…”

But I still want to try. Because, after all, we’re petite bourgeoisie.
